| RP quintet raring to play tune-up tiffs
PHILIPPINE National Team coach Yeng Guiao said his squad is raring to play some tune-up games prior to the Southeast Asia Basketball Association Championships, which will serve as the qualifying tournament for the Fiba Asia Championships in China in August. The Asian Championships will in turn decide which teams go into the 2010 World Cup in Turkey. ?We are coming along fine and most of the players are available right now after we gave some players the time and luxury to refresh themselves at the end of the recent All Filipino Conference,? Guiao told www.insidesports.ph, Standard Today and Viva Sports at the team?s practice at The Arena in San Juan on Monday. ?The players are all very comfortable with each other and the chemistry is good. We are actually raring to play some tune-up games but for one reason or another, they did not push through,? added Guiao. He said the nationals expect to play some games in the very near future. ?We are just preparing ourselves.? Guiao said a two-game series against an Australian squad made up of players from the National Basketball League would be a good preparation for the Seaba. PBA Commissioner Sonny Barrios said the pro-league had practically closed a deal with an Australian group. ?We are looking forward to having them play on the April 3 and 5.? The latest information on the Seaba from Fiba Asia secretary general Datu Yeoh of Malaysia is that the tournament will take place in the first week of June, although there is no word yet on the site.
